Q: Is 941,700 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 941,700 is a composite number.

Why is 941,700 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 941,700 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 10 12 15 20 25 30 43 50 60 73 75 86 100 129 146 150 172 215 219 258 292 300 365 430 438 516 645 730 860 876 1,075 1,095 1,290 1,460 1,825 2,150 2,190 2,580 3,139 3,225 3,650 4,300 4,380 5,475 6,278 6,450 7,300 9,417 10,950 12,556 12,900 15,695 18,834 21,900 31,390 37,668 47,085 62,780 78,475 94,170 156,950 188,340 235,425 313,900 470,850 and 941,700, with no remainder.

Since 941,700 cannot be divided by just 1 and 941,700, it is a composite number.
